Large size diamonds in demand

Small goods weak but in oversupply

diamond world news service

According to market reports prices of large sized diamonds, preferably above 5ct continue to rise as dollar weakens. Mid sizes and caraters are stable while small goods remain weak but in oversupply.

The increased demand for big sixed diamonds is attributed to the rise in global affluent class and a weak Dollar.
